
Metabolism: From Cellular Mechanisms to Development and Disease
Date: 21 – 23 June 2027
Location: St Mary’s Marylebone, London, UK
Organisers: Sally Dunwoodie, Irene Miguel-Aliaga, Satdarshan [Paul] Singh Monga and Hans-Georg Sprenger
Metabolism – the integrated network of biochemical reactions that provides energy, generates cellular building blocks and regulates cellular functions – lies at the heart of life. Over the past decade, advances in cell biology, genetics, imaging, modelling and systems-level approaches have revealed that metabolism is a dynamic and highly regulated driver of cell fate, tissue development and organismal health. This meeting brings together researchers from diverse disciplines to explore the latest discoveries at the interface of cell biology, developmental biology and disease modelling, fostering discussion, collaboration, and new insights into how metabolic regulation shapes both normal physiology and disease pathology.
Topics will include:
- Technologies to study compartmentalised metabolism
- Mitochondrial metabolism and metabolite signalling
- Metabolic control of cell fate
- Metabolism and tissue development
- Metabolism in development, health and disease
